Understanding the Sydney Market

Labourer roles in Sydney see varied pay based on your skills and the project type. Having specific certifications and machinery experience moves you to the higher end of the range. For example, a forklift license or confined spaces certification is highly valued because it allows you to handle more complex and critical tasks safely. Demand for Labourers remains strong, especially with ongoing infrastructure projects, and major contractors like John Holland and CPB Contractors are often hiring.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is a good starting salary for a junior Labourer in Sydney?
Starting pay for Labourers is typically around $54,500. This is common for those new to the industry or without specific certifications like a White Card or machinery experience.
Is $64,610 a good salary in Sydney?
The median salary of $64,610 is fair for a Labourer in Sydney. However, given Sydney's high cost of living, especially for rent, it can be tight without additional skills or overtime.
How much does a Senior Labourer make in Sydney?
Senior Labourers can earn up to $85,000. This pay comes from extensive experience, holding multiple certifications like a forklift license and confined spaces, and proven ability to operate specialised machinery.
